With over 350 exhibitors covering more than 56,000 net square feet of
exhibit space, this years Show the 8th edition is now the biggest AHR Expo-México ever. Over
6,000 HVAC&R professionals from across Mexico
and Latin America are expected to converge at Mexicos
largest HVAC&R event to be held at the Cintermex in Monterrey N.L., Mexico,
September 23-25, 2008.
AHR Expo-México features exhibitors from 15 countries showcasing the
latest air conditioning, heating, refrigeration and ventilation equipment and
solutions, with many products being newly introduced to the Latin American
marketplace. In addition, both visitors and exhibitors will have the
opportunity to attend over 40 educational
sessions on the latest technologies organized by the ASHRAE Monterrey
Chapter. According to the organizers press release, over the three days, and for
a nominal fee, visitors can attend sessions on the latest protocols and
standards, ways to optimize system efficiency, and more. This years Show will
be a whos who of some of the largest companies in the HVAC&R industry,
including: Emerson Climate Technologies, Friedrich Air Conditioning Co.,
Invensys, Johnson Controls de Mexico, Lennox Global, McQuay International,
Samsung, Trane de Mexico, to name just a few.
